Transaction 63a0758a5889ea3f300f644291768a516b67c5c5021a51935b072bfe62597c41
1 Input
1 Output
-
63a0758a5889ea3f300f644291768a516b67c5c5021a51935b072bfe62597c41:0
- value
- 24999730
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1a04ee91caf16642a30701388fc2a88bac2a6569 OP_EQUAL
- address
- 344bQCwH3GLarEqHaVcMfSGoUcENaQo8Dg